At PiedRéseau Saint-Léonard, we offer a specialized service in orthopaedic shoes designed to address various foot and leg conditions. Our podiatrists may prescribe these shoes to treat plantar deformities and mechanical abnormalities, which, if untreated, can lead to chronic pain and musculoskeletal issues. We provide a variety of orthopaedic shoes tailored to meet individual needs, including street shoes for office environments, children’s shoes for early correction of deformities, work shoes for active individuals, custom shoes for severe conditions, and prefabricated options for less severe issues. Each type of shoe is designed to enhance comfort, stability, and protection, ensuring that our patients can maintain an active lifestyle without compromising their foot health.
